



Altus Flute 907/A9
Altus Artist flutes offer exceptional hand craftsmanship, tonal color, and playability. The Altus 907/A9 is their most popular upgrade model for the more learned flutist. Enhanced with a .958 Britannia silver headjoint, the 907/A9 has an acutely accurate scale and tuned harmonics. Full of colorful overtones, this flute enables the budding performer more opportunity to explore and develop their tone and musical expression. Features include a handmade, silver-plated mechanism known for its durability and exceptional fluidity and feel, the Altus/Bennett scale, drawn toneholes, French-pointed arms, and stainless steel springs. Options include a split-E mechanism, C# trill key, 14k Gold riser, 14k Gold lip plate and riser, and choice of Altus Classic, Z-cut, or V-cut headjoint.
The Altus 907 has the following standard features:
- .958 Britannia silver headjoint
- silver-plated body and mechansim
- stainless steel springs
- drawn tone holes
- open holes
- B foot with gizmo
- A-442
- choice of in-line or off-set G
- choice of Altus Classic, Z-cut, or V-cut headjoint
